Kombiverkehr offers alternative services during full closure in Denmark
07/14/2020
The line between the Danish towns of Ringsted and Korsør will be completely closed from 8 p.m. on 17 July to 4 a.m. on 27 July 2020. As a result, the direct trains operated by Kombiverkehr between Herne and SE-Malmö, NL-Coevorden and SE-Malmö, Lübeck-Dänischburg CTL and SE- Stockholm Norra will not run via Denmark. 

However, our flexible network options allow us to continue to offer our customers the customary reliable service by rail: from 17 July to 27 July 2020, Kombiverkehr will provide a total of 28 train departures as broken services via the ferry connections to and from Lübeck-Skandinavienkai.

The direct train service offered by Kombiverkehr between Cologne and SE-Malmö is likewise unable to run during that period. As an alternative to this service, we have increased the frequency of departures between Duisburg-Ruhrort Hafen Ubf DUSS and Lübeck-Skandinavienkai with onward connection to southern Sweden by two return trips per week, giving a new total of 13 train departures in each direction every week.
